Nontransgression Meaning In Bengali

Nontransgression শব্দের বাংলা অর্থ কি: অনতিক্রমণ

Nontransgression

অনতিক্রমণ অনতিক্রম অলঙ্ঘন

Definition

1) Nontransgression refers to the act of not violating a rule, law, or boundary. It is the absence of crossing over limits or boundaries.
2) Nontransgression can also refer to maintaining integrity, sticking to moral principles, and avoiding wrongdoing or breaking a commitment.
3) In a broader context, nontransgression can refer to respecting the rights, beliefs, and boundaries of others, promoting harmony and understanding through non-offending actions.
